Merry Cemetery
The Merry Cemetery in Săpânța, Romania, is renowned for its colorful wooden crosses featuring naive paintings and humorous poems that depict the lives and occupations of the deceased. Established in 1935, it is an open-air museum and unique tourist attraction symbolizing local culture and a joyful perspective on death.
